#2: Mariah Carey’s VMAs Showstopper (1997)

After her marriage to music executive Tommy Mottola ended, Mariah Carey entered a new era. She effectively reintroduced herself to the world at the 14th MTV Video Music Awards in 1997, when she arrived in an all-black two-piece ensemble. While this look had plenty of style, it was about much more than just fashion. The long high-slit skirt paired with a matching crop top seemingly symbolized her breaking free of the control Mottola had over her life. It was a pivotal moment for the five-octave songstress, as she regained control of not only her image, but also her sense of self.

#1: Princess Diana’s Little Black Dress (1994)

It was basically the moment that coined the term “revenge dress,” setting the standard for any and all post-break-up looks that followed. When Princess Diana arrived at the Serpentine Gallery for an event in 1994, jaws across the world dropped. Did we mention that her soon-to-be ex-husband Prince Charles was publicly addressing his not-so-secret relationship with Camilla Parker-Bowles that same evening? Diana stole the show, stunning everyone in a mesmerizing evening dress designed by Christina Stambolian. While it reportedly wasn’t the garment she had first planned on donning, her decision to wear it was undoubtedly the right one. It’s still one of the most talked-about looks ever, proving that the best kind of revenge is a little black dress.
